About the Species
The Gaur has a dark brown hide, which approaches black when the Gaur ages. The lower part of the Gaur's legs is pure white. The Gaur's horns are either Yellow or Greenish with Black Tips.
About the Hunt
Gaur is considered to be quite dangerous to hunt. It can be extremely aggressive, especially at a wounding. With a accurate shot, a caliber .375 riffle will be appropriate for shooting a Gaur.
Habitat
Gaur habitat is characterized by large, relatively undisturbed forest tracts, hilly terrain below an elevation of 1,500 to 1,800 m (4,900 to 5,900 ft), availability of water, and an abundance of forage in the form of grasses, bamboo, shrubs, and trees.
